Dishes mentioned
Pizza Margherita
This Margherita has a beautifully crunchy crust — I love how crispy it is. It's New York style but done right, probably the best New York style pizza I've ever had. The mozzarella is real mozzarella, not that processed stuff. The dough is really good even on its own, a mix between Roman and New York style, leaning more towards Roman. The tomato sauce is a bit salty, a bit pushed with salt, but actually it's almost perfect. It's much less chewy, lighter, feels smaller, like it lasts less — two bites and it's gone.
